    Summary: Debian's Advanced Packaging Tool with RPM support
    Description: 
    A port of Debian's APT tools for RPM based distributions,
    or at least for Conectiva. It provides the apt-get utility that
    provides a simpler, safer way to install and upgrade packages.
    APT features complete installation ordering, multiple source
    capability and several other unique features.
    
    This package is still under development.
